Extracting LEF Hierarchically in Innovus

Alen Duvnjak
Alen Duvnjak over 5 years ago

Hello,

I am currently using Innovus to build a hierarchical design where the levels of hierarchy can range from 2 to 6/7. I'm having some issues right now getting the -extractBlockObs flag to work for the write_lef_abstract command. It does not seem to want to pull the obstruction information from my lower level LEF(s). I verified that they are marked as CLASS BLOCK. Any suggestions?

Also, on a side note, is there any way for write_lef_abstract to extract VIA information? This would be extremely useful in my current flow, but I have been unable to get this to work as of now.
